The oldest-old which is the weakest group of the old is that kind of groupthat needs the help mostly and has more difficulties. Therefore, it is not onlythe need of building up an all-around society but also the necessity of thesocial development that we should deal with the problem well.Due to the lack of the data of the oldest-old in China and the difficulty ofcollecting data, the study of the oldest-old is just a new field in China, and it isstill blank in some aspects. This paper tries to make analyses of the oldest-oldin China in terms of the current situation and the trend of the oldest-old inChina with the purpose of finding out the problems of the oldest-old andgiving some immaturely proposals.The result of the study shows that since the founding of People'sRepublic of China, the oldest-old has been increasing at a high rate. On theage structure, most of the oldest-old belongs to the range between 80 and 89;on the sex structure, the sexual rate of the oldest-old is very low with thehigher rate of female;on the geographical structure, most of the oldest-old areliving in the unbalanced country sides. In basic, the majority of the presentsingle oldest-old have got married, but many of them received low educationbecause of the historical limitation. Besides, most of the oldest-old suffer a lotfrom diseases due to their poor physical conditions. However, according tosome researches, many oldest-old in China can take care of themselves verywell. What's more important, people in the country do better than those in thetowns, male than female. The oldest-old in China, especially those in thecountry are depended on their family members mostly in the aspects ofattendance, the source of living, and housing.Besides, this paper is based on the data of the population censes in 2000with the total fertility rate as the controlling parameter, using PEOPLE andEXCELL to make an analysis of the trend of the oldest-old in China. Theresult of this analysis demonstrates that the oldest-old is increasing at thefastest rate in China, which has become a block in the development of China.The main problems existing in the oldest-old are: firstly, theincompatibility between the high rate increase and the social development;secondly, the low rate between female and male with more problemsconcerning female;thirdly, the oldest-old in trouble in the country posses ahigh proportion;fourthly, there is a great challenge in taking care of theoldest-old;fifthly, many of the oldest-old are lack of high quality of spirituallife because of the low education. Besides, there are also problems in theaspects of spouse, physical conditions and so on.At last, there are some immaturely proposals for us to deal with theproblems of the oldest-old in China: the first is enhancing a sustaineddevelopment of the economy;secondly, making some feasible laws andsystems;thirdly, cultivating the all-around oldest-old awareness;fourthly,making the age-providing system and medical system that has Chinesecharacteristics;fifthly, we should pay more attention to the female oldest-oldin the country. Of course, there are some other measures, such as modifyingthe present birth policy, developing the insurance which suit to the oldest-old.
